Add colors to the Statue of Liberty, the Stars and Stripes, and even a star-spangled Happy Face. Do it all — and more. Crayons, felt tip pens, and paints help you easily produce glowing stained glass effects when finished illustrations are placed near a source of bright light. 8 designs.
